Before water is turned off:

  • You may wish to store sufficient water for your requirements during this period.
  • Ensure that all taps are turned off and appliances, which use water, are not in operation.
  • Please note that hot water services should not be operated during this time to avoid possible damage.
  • Prior to shut down, any instantaneous hot water heaters should be switched off.

After water is turned on:

  • On resumption of the water supply a hot water tap should be turned on to flush any air pockets from the pipes, then turn the hot water heater on again.
  • The water quality may not be of the usual standard and in some instances the water may appear discoloured, however, the water is safe for use.
  • We advise that you check the water prior to use. If it appears discoloured we suggest you turn on the nearest external tap to the meter and let it run for a period of time, or until it runs clear, and then do the same to the furthest external tap from the meter, to clear your pipework.
  • Please do not wash clothes at this time to prevent staining from any discoloured water.

If your water supply does not resume, low pressure is experienced, or the water remains discoloured after some time, please contact Council’s Call Centre on telephone 1300 883 699 to report the fault.

Important advice:

  • Maintenance of the sewerage system is essential and Council needs to complete these planned works to ensure the sewerage system operates effectively.
  • The completion of these scheduled works are dependent on weather and other work commitments and may be subject to change.

While works are being completed:

  • You may hear the cleaning machinery in the pipework while this work is being completed, this is normal.
  • Toilets, sinks etc. can still be used as normal, though while not in use residents are advised to ensure toilet lids are kept down during this period. While being a rare occurrence air may be released through the toilet pans. This situation is normally caused by partial blockages within the property owner’s sanitary house drain that prevents the vent on the drain from functioning correctly.
